The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the South East with a requirement for JMeter sk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ited JMeter over the 6 months to 23 April 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
23 Apr 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 367 364 396
Rank change year-on-year -3 +32 -63
Permanent jobs citing JMeter 29 50 86
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the South East 0.17% 0.33% 0.44%
As % of the Development Applications category 1.91% 2.38% 2.22%
Number of salaries quoted 16 19 38
10th Percentile £42,708 £47,500 £41,838
25th Percentile £46,250 £60,000 £42,500
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£53,750 £70,000 £55,000
Median % change year-on-year -23.21% +27.27% +4.76%
75th Percentile £68,750 £75,000 £70,000
90th Percentile - - £71,500
England median annual salary £65,000 £65,000 £60,000
% change year-on-year - +8.33% +4.35%
